I applied through college or university.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Bloomberg (London, England) in Jan 2017
Interview
I directly send the CV to their HR team. Have a phone interview with Hackerrank to solve some easy coding questions. Then I was invited to their work place. Just one round for onsite for me, others may get two or three rounds including HR round. One week later I got rejected.
Interview questions [2]
Question 1
Give a vector of strings and two string A and B, find all postitions that word A and B are adjacent.
